From: Gary Benson Date: Thu, 2 Apr 2015 12:38:28 +0000 (+0100) Subject: Introduce target_filesystem_is_local X-Git-Url: https://git.libre-soc.org/?a=commitdiff_plain;h=4bd7dc42558fcf53bb0c783f852f03dcac38866f;p=binutils-gdb.git Introduce target_filesystem_is_local This commit introduces a new target method target_filesystem_is_local which can be used to determine whether or not the filesystem accessed by the target_fileio_* methods is the local filesystem. gdb/ChangeLog: * target.h (struct target_ops) : New field. (target_filesystem_is_local): New macro. * target-delegates.c: Regenerate. * remote.c (remote_filesystem_is_local): New function.
